The Nutribullet is strong enough to blend them right into a smoothie which is still so amazing to me. And now here is my recipe for this yummy green banana almond smoothie:
Here’s What You Will Need:
- 1/2 Coconut Milk (I use the kind from Trader Joe’s)
- 1 Banana
- Heaping Handful of Spinach
- 1 Scoop Protein Powder (I used one that is unflavored so it didn’t change the flavor of the smoothie. This is what I used.)
- 1 Handful Raw Almonds (only about 7-8)
- 1 tsp raw honey (optional)
- 3-4 Ice Cubes
Take all the ingredients and put in the Nutribullet (I used the large cup). Blend until smooth.
